The sum of three consecutive multiples of 3 is equal to 6 more than four times the smallest multiple. What is the largest multip

le ?.
a.)9
b.)12
c.)15
d.)18
Mathematics
2 answers:
Setler79 [48]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:  (a) 9

<u>Step-by-step explanation:</u>

1st multiple of 3: 1(3x)

2nd multiple of 3: 2(3x)

3rd multiple of 3: 3(3x)

Sum = 4(1st multiple of 3) + 6


1(3x) + 2(3x) + 3(3x) = 4(3x) + 6

 3x  +    6x  +    9x  =  12x  + 6

                        18x  = 12x + 6

                          6x =           6

                            x = 1


Largest (3rd) multiple is: 3(3x)

                                      = 9x

                                      = 9 · 1

                                      = 9

Prove that the quadrilateral whose vertices are I(-2,3), J(2,6), K(7,6), and L(3, 3) is a rhombus.

I think in these problems the first step is to express each side as a vector.  A vector is the difference between points.  When two sides have the same vector (or negatives) it means they're parallel and congruent.  So in a rhombus IJKL the vectors IJ and LK should be the same, as should JK and IL.  That much assures a parallelogram; we check IJ and JK are congruent to complete the crowing of the rhombus.

Let's calculate these vectors:

IJ = J - I = (2,6) - (-2,3) = (2 - -2, 6 - 3) = (4, 3)

LK = K - L = (7, 6) - (3, 3) = (4, 3)

IJ = LK, so far so good

(Note: If you haven't got to vectors yet you can just show the two sides are the same length, 5, and have the same slope, 3/4, both of which can be read off the vectors.)

JK = K - J = (7,6) - (2,6) = (5,0)

IL = L - I = (3, 3) - (-2, 3)  = (5, 0)

Those are the same too.    

Now we have to show IJ ≅ JK

The length of IJ is the cliche √4²+3² = 5, the same as JK, so IJ ≅ JK

We showed all four sides are congruent and we have two pair of parallel sides, so we have a rhombus.

For this problem we have the following parameters given:

\mu = 40, \sigma =8

And for this case we want to find the percentage of lightbulb replacement requests numbering between 24 and 40.

From the empirical rule we know that we have 68% of the values within one deviation from the mean, 95% of the values within 2 deviations and 99.7% within 3 deviations.

We can find the number of deviations from themean for the limits with the z score formula we got:

z=\frac{X-\mu}{\sigma}

And replacing we got:

z=\frac{24-40}{8}=-2

z=\frac{40-40}{8}=0

And then the percentage between 24 and 40 would be \frac{95}{2}= 47.5 \%
